Armenian wine and brandy can offer importers a distinctive origin story and a portfolio that stands apart from familiar producing regions. Commercial success, however, depends on more than heritage. Buyers need the right style, price architecture, documentation, packaging, and supply reliability for their market.
Define the portfolio role
Decide whether you need an entry-level retail item, a premium restaurant listing, a gift product, or a specialist discovery range. Share target retail prices, sales channels, bottle formats, expected volume, and competing products. This helps producers recommend the right labels.
Evaluate the product systematically
Request technical sheets covering style, grape or raw material, origin, alcohol level, maturation, serving guidance, bottle and case format, and available awards or certifications. Taste samples under consistent conditions and record feedback from sales, hospitality, and target consumers.
Confirm labels and market compliance
Alcohol rules vary significantly by destination. Before ordering, confirm registration, label wording, health warnings, language, tax stamps, bottle sizes, laboratory documents, and importer responsibilities with qualified local professionals. Allow time for artwork approval and any required analysis.
Plan temperature-aware logistics
Discuss seasonal shipping, warehouse conditions, pallet protection, case strength, insurance, and breakage procedures. Calculate landed cost using the selected delivery terms and all destination charges. A lower bottle price can be offset by inefficient packaging or small, expensive shipments.
Support the launch with a story and plan
Ask the producer for approved brand assets, estate or facility images, tasting notes, origin details, and staff training materials. Build a launch plan across tastings, restaurants, retail education, social content, and distributor sales teams. Use only substantiated heritage and award claims.
